What is the Story behind the Slogan “Let’s remove the shackles”?

Published March 11, 2016
Share
SHARE

[wzslider autoplay=”true”]In the past several days, the public has been intrigued by chained tractors and sewing machines placed at city squares with large banners saying “Let’s remove the shackles”.

The same slogan could be seen on billboards, media and social networks, so the citizens wondered what it is all about for a reason.

“The slogan actually implies the opportunity for economic-social recovery of BiH through the implementation of economic reforms from the Reform Agenda. For 20 years now our society has been chained with the chains of stagnation, unemployment, poverty and lack of competitiveness,” it was stated.

With the signing of the Reform Agenda, a process of recovery of the domestic market has begun, with the aim of strengthening the sustainable, efficient, socially just and stable economic growth. Implementation of economic reforms is the key to the recovery of BiH that should result in better competitiveness, larger investments and export, new workplaces, and eventually better standard.

Hence, the slogan “Let’s remove the shackles” accurately describes what the implementation of economic reforms means for an ordinary citizen of BiH, because the reforms are the only way of liberating ourselves from the chains of inefficient system and heading to a better future.

Chains from tractors and sewing machines in Sarajevo, Bihać, Mostar, Zenica and Tuzla were removed yesterday, while apples and domestic-production socks were given to people. This symbolically presented the removing of shackles from domestic economy and announcement of better days for BiH economy, stated the implementers of the campaign from Via Media.
